Alex, there are many tuners that will do the job just fine, and for very little money at the moment. An Accuphase would probably cost a bit more that you'd like to spend and you'd probably get into a bidding war with Neil over one of those. A Troughline will give you a great sound as long as you have a decent signal available to you. It would also cost under £100, but if you have to add a decent aerial & have it realigned etc, you might be better off going for a Japanese model. Personally I think that manual units are best & couldn't contemplate owning anything too much beyond Andre's musical timeframe (well, OK '79/80 then).
